    Where to buy in Canada?

    Hi all,

    I've been dedicated to Megs products for the past 5 or so years because they rock. I just did my first wax of the year (for Mother's Day) and I ran out of Deep Crystal Cleaner. It works great at prepping the surface and I haven't been able to find any other products on the market that are for this purpose. Anyways, I just went to Canadian Tire and they no longer carry any of the Deep Crystal products. I couldn't even find another paste wax can of NXT 2.0 (which has me EXTREMELY worried). I also went to Wal Mart and same deal.

    Someone please tell me where I can buy these products in Ontario Canada!

    There was a time when you could even buy the professional line of products from Canadian Tire, but that hasn't be so for the past few years... What's the deal?
